One of our biggest accomplishments from 2017 is the National Recognition for Excellence we received for the after school program from the Mexican Government. Despite this recognition, we continue to seek ways to improve because Jesus makes everything He touches better. One project we would like to start doing on a regular basis is recycle-centric crafts with the kids. There is so much plastic waste here in Juarez, and we want to teach our kids more about recycling and being mindful about waste. For Christmas the kids used old newspaper to make ornaments that adorned the Amigo Fiel tree. Many of the children showed dedication and a special creative flair when doing this project that we had not seen before. Our next project will involve plastic water bottles… stay tuned to see the final product. A special highlight from December and January were the multiple visits to nursing homes throughout the city. Each group that comes from the United States brings gifts to give to the residents to help keep them warm and comfortable during the winter season. One reason we are passionate about working with children and the elderly is because they are often a forgotten part of society. Some of these nursing homes reflect just that. The funding is often nonexistent, therefore the living conditions are cold and uncomfortable, with food being scarce at times. People like you come on a mission trip bringing joy and the hope of Jesus Christ to these people. Taking time to share a smile and a gift bag filled with things like shampoo, blankets, warm sweaters, socks, and slippers. Simple things that bring a world of physical and spiritual comfort to the residents of these nursing homes. Love and serve.
